Aidan O’Brien could earn his ninth Breeders’ Cup winner through Alice Springs but a wide draw may scupper Hit It A BombAidan O’Brien has trained eight winners at the Breeders’ Cup,a total which compares well with the record of many of the top names in American racing, including Todd Pletcher, and who has seven,and the veteran Bill Mott, with nine. When you consider, or too,that most of O’Brien’s horses are bred for turf rather than the dirt on which the majority of the assembly’s 13 events are staged, his overall return stands comparison with any of his American counterparts.
Yet O’Brien has saddled nearly 100 runners at the assembly, or too,which also needs to be borne in mind before the first day of the 32nd Breeders’ Cup at Keeneland on Friday. O’Brien will send out the likely favourite for both of the two races on grass, the Juvenile Turf and the Juvenile Fillies’ Turf, and but these races are fiercely competitive and it will be a remarkable achievement,even by O’Brien’s standards, if he can record a double.
